Are VCC's the same as Gift-type credit cards?

Discussion in 'Social Networking Sites' started by samiejg, Apr 26, 2014.

  1. samiejg

    samiejg Senior Member

    Dec 14, 2013
    Likes Received:
    Like the title says, are VCC's the same as Gift-type credit cards? I'm trying to signup for Facebook ads but unfortunately I do not own a credit card of my own. I know the store down the road has ones you can purchase, but I think they are known as "gift credit cards". Would that work? Or what would I need to do to get setup with Facebook without owning a credit card?